How to use Enable geolocation tracking setting( latitude and longitude) values in a case
How to use location values captured when we set "Enable geolocation tracking" on Case Type rule.

Geolocation tracking captures the longitude and latitude coordinates of caseworkers as they process a case. You can view this information in a Google Map or access it systematically on the pyRecordHistoryList.pxResults clipboard page. By default, this feature is enabled when you create an application, built directly on PegaRULES, using the New Application Wizard.
